Călărași is steeped in history, with several landmarks that reflect its cultural heritage. One of the most significant sites is the Călărași Monastery, founded in the 17th century. This serene location offers visitors a glimpse into the past with its intricate architecture and peaceful surroundings. The monastery is a perfect spot for quiet reflection and appreciating the beauty of religious art.
Another notable landmark is the Old Town Hall, a fine example of neoclassical architecture. Visitors can admire its grand façade and learn about the town's administrative history. The nearby Danube River Promenade is another must-visit spot, where you can enjoy leisurely walks along the river, take in the stunning views, and soak up the local atmosphere.
The beauty of Călărași extends beyond its historical landmarks. The surrounding landscapes offer numerous opportunities for outdoor enthusiasts. Just outside the town lies the Calarași Nature Reserve, a haven for birdwatchers and nature lovers. The reserve is home to a diverse range of flora and fauna, including various bird species that migrate along the Danube.
For those looking to engage in outdoor activities, the river provides ample options for water sports, including kayaking and fishing. The tranquil waters of the Danube are perfect for a relaxing day on the river, allowing visitors to connect with nature while enjoying the scenic views.

Călărași is not only rich in history and nature but also in culinary offerings. The local cuisine is a delightful blend of traditional Romanian flavors with a modern twist. Visitors should not miss the chance to sample local dishes such as sarmale (cabbage rolls), mămăligă (cornmeal porridge), and various grilled meats.
The town also hosts various markets and festivals throughout the year, showcasing local artisans, crafts, and culinary specialties. Engaging with local culture is an enriching experience, allowing visitors to gain insights into the traditions and lifestyle of the residents.
